Xc9536芯片用什么编程

fiy 其他 50

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    XC9536芯片是一种可编程逻辑器件(CPLD),它可以使用编程器进行编程。常见的编程器有Xilinx公司的JTAG编程器和第三方编程器。这些编程器通过与芯片的编程接口连接,将编程数据下载到XC9536芯片中,从而实现对芯片功能的配置和定制。

    在使用编程器进行编程之前,首先需要准备好编程器和编程软件。编程器通常是一个硬件设备,可通过USB或并行端口与计算机连接。编程软件则是用于编写和调试编程代码的工具。在使用编程器之前,需要安装并配置好编程软件,以确保能够正确地与XC9536芯片进行通信。

    编程XC9536芯片的过程通常包括以下步骤:

    1. 连接编程器:将编程器与计算机连接,并通过编程接口(如JTAG接口)连接到XC9536芯片。
    2. 打开编程软件:启动编程软件,并选择正确的编程器和目标设备(即XC9536芯片)。
    3. 导入设计文件:将设计文件导入编程软件中,设计文件通常是使用硬件描述语言(HDL)编写的,如VHDL或Verilog。
    4. 配置芯片:根据设计文件中的逻辑电路,生成对XC9536芯片的编程配置数据。
    5. 下载编程数据:将编程软件中生成的编程配置数据下载到XC9536芯片中。这通常是通过编程器将数据传输到芯片的非易失性存储器中。
    6. 验证编程结果:通过编程软件提供的验证功能,检查XC9536芯片是否成功编程。
    7. 测试功能:在芯片上电后,使用测试仪器或其他方式验证XC9536芯片的功能是否符合预期。

    需要注意的是,编程XC9536芯片需要一定的专业知识和技术,建议在进行编程操作之前,详细阅读相关的芯片手册和编程器说明,以确保正确操作并避免损坏芯片。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Xc9536芯片是一种可编程逻辑器件(Programmable Logic Device,PLD),它可以通过编程来实现特定的功能。编程Xc9536芯片主要使用的是硬件描述语言(Hardware Description Language,HDL)和相应的开发工具。下面是关于Xc9536芯片编程的五个要点:

    1. 硬件描述语言:常用的硬件描述语言有VHDL(VHSIC Hardware Description Language)和Verilog。这些语言用于描述电路的结构和功能,并将其转化为PLD芯片可以理解的形式。编程人员可以使用这些语言来编写逻辑功能,并将其转化为Xc9536芯片可执行的二进制文件。

    2. 开发工具:为了编程Xc9536芯片,需要使用相应的开发工具。Xilinx是一家著名的PLD芯片制造商,他们提供了一套完整的开发工具套件,称为Xilinx ISE。ISE提供了图形化界面和命令行界面,可以用于设计、仿真、编程和调试Xc9536芯片。

    3. 设计流程:编程Xc9536芯片需要按照一定的设计流程进行。首先,需要进行电路设计,使用HDL语言描述电路的结构和功能。然后,通过仿真工具对设计进行验证,确保其符合预期的功能和性能要求。接下来,使用开发工具将设计转化为可执行的二进制文件。最后,将二进制文件下载到Xc9536芯片中,实现所需的逻辑功能。

    4. 编程方式:Xc9536芯片可以通过多种方式进行编程。最常见的方式是通过JTAG(Joint Test Action Group)接口进行编程。这是一种通用的接口标准,用于将开发工具与PLD芯片连接起来。通过JTAG接口,可以将编译后的二进制文件下载到Xc9536芯片中。此外,还可以使用编程器等专用设备进行编程。

    5. 调试和优化:在编程Xc9536芯片的过程中,可能会出现一些问题,如逻辑错误、时序问题等。为了解决这些问题,可以使用开发工具提供的调试功能进行逐步调试。同时,还可以使用性能分析工具对设计进行优化,以提高逻辑功能的性能和效率。

    总之,编程Xc9536芯片需要使用硬件描述语言和相应的开发工具,按照设计流程进行操作。通过合适的编程方式,可以将设计转化为可执行的二进制文件,并下载到Xc9536芯片中。在编程过程中,还需要进行调试和优化,以确保设计的正确性和性能。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Xc9536芯片是一种可编程逻辑设备(PLD),它可以通过编程来实现特定的功能。编程Xc9536芯片通常使用的是一种叫做"JTAG"(联合测试行动组)的编程接口。

    下面是使用JTAG编程Xc9536芯片的操作流程:

    1. 准备编程工具和设备:首先,您需要准备一个JTAG编程器,它是用来与Xc9536芯片通信并进行编程的工具。同时,您还需要一台计算机来运行编程软件,并且需要一个适配器将编程器连接到计算机的USB端口。

    2. 连接编程器和芯片:将编程器的JTAG接口与Xc9536芯片的JTAG接口相连接。这通常是通过一条JTAG线缆来实现的。确保连接是正确的并且牢固的。

    3. 安装编程软件:在计算机上安装编程软件。Xilinx公司的iMPACT是一个常用的编程软件,它可以用于编程Xc9536芯片。安装完成后,打开软件并选择正确的设备和接口。

    4. 配置编程选项:在编程软件中配置编程选项,例如选择正确的芯片型号、设置编程模式等。这些选项可能会有所不同,具体取决于所使用的编程软件。

    5. 读取和验证芯片:在编程软件中选择"读取"选项,以读取Xc9536芯片的当前配置。然后,进行验证以确保读取的配置与期望的配置相匹配。

    6. 编写并加载设计文件:使用设计工具(如Xilinx的ISE软件)编写设计文件,并将其生成为可被编程软件识别的格式(如bit文件)。将生成的bit文件加载到编程软件中。

    7. 编程芯片:在编程软件中选择"编程"选项,以将设计文件加载到Xc9536芯片中。编程过程可能需要一些时间,具体时间取决于设计文件的大小和复杂度。

    8. 验证编程结果:在编程完成后,再次进行验证以确保芯片已正确编程。可以使用编程软件中的"验证"选项来检查芯片的配置。

    总结:使用JTAG编程器和编程软件可以实现对Xc9536芯片的编程。通过连接编程器和芯片、配置编程选项、加载设计文件并进行编程,最后进行验证,可以确保芯片被正确地编程。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部